KKR end home dominance in IPL 2024 with seven-wicket thrashing of RCB

FirstCricket Staff • April 5, 2024, 16:59:03 IST
Whatsapp Facebook Twitter

Virat Kohli’s unbeaten 83 went in vain as Kolkata Knight Riders ended up chasing down the 183-run target set by Royal Challengers Bengaluru with seven wickets and more than three overs to spare.
